PaddlePaddle框架的工作流程通常包括以下幾個步驟:
數(shù)據(jù)準(zhǔn)備:首先需要準(zhǔn)備訓(xùn)練和測試數(shù)據(jù)集,包括數(shù)據(jù)的讀取、預(yù)處理和劃分。
模型構(gòu)建:根據(jù)任務(wù)需求選擇合適的模型結(jié)構(gòu),并使用PaddlePaddle提供的API或自定義網(wǎng)絡(luò)結(jié)構(gòu)來構(gòu)建模型。
模型訓(xùn)練:使用準(zhǔn)備好的數(shù)據(jù)集和構(gòu)建好的模型進(jìn)行訓(xùn)練,通過定義優(yōu)化器、損失函數(shù)和訓(xùn)練循環(huán)來迭代優(yōu)化模型參數(shù)。
模型評估:在訓(xùn)練完成后,使用測試數(shù)據(jù)集對模型進(jìn)行評估,計算模型在測試集上的性能指標(biāo)。
模型部署:將訓(xùn)練好的模型部署到生產(chǎn)環(huán)境中,用于實際應(yīng)用。
整個工作流程可以根據(jù)具體的任務(wù)和需求進(jìn)行調(diào)整和修改,但以上步驟是PaddlePaddle框架通用的工作流程。